fre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

電子時(shí)鐘實(shí)習(xí)報(bào)告-文庫(kù)吧資料

2024-09-06 12:42本頁(yè)面
  

【正文】 */ void Timer1Interrupt(void) interrupt 3 //秒表定時(shí) { TR1=0。 TL0=Timer0_L。 SPK=!SPK。 fen=0。 mmiao=0。 display_mb()。 } if(flag11==2) //暫停秒表,紀(jì)錄時(shí)間 { TR1=0。 //蜂鳴器開始報(bào)時(shí),幾點(diǎn)鐘就報(bào)幾聲 delay(4000)。 //12 點(diǎn)之前,顯示“下午” display_nz2()。 display_nz1()。 else j=2*i。 flag7=0。 } TR0=0。 //節(jié)拍時(shí)長(zhǎng) i=i+3。 Timer0_L=FREQL[k]。 while(i100) { //音樂(lè)數(shù)組長(zhǎng)度 ,唱完從頭再來(lái) k=MUSIC[i]+7*MUSIC[i+1]1。 TR0=1。 } if(flag6==1) //鬧鐘到,播放音樂(lè)世上只有媽媽好 { unsigned char k,i=0。 break。 18 } case 1: //鬧鐘時(shí)間到,顯示鬧鐘時(shí)間 { LCD_clear()。 LCD_display_time()。 //處理 DS1302 信息 LCD_clear()。 //按鍵掃描獲得鍵值 DS_gettime()。 //初始化設(shè)置時(shí)間 init_interrupt()。//有錯(cuò) display()。 //液晶清屏 DS_init()。 } void main() { LCD_init()。 EA = 1。 TH1 = 0x0DC。 //打開全局中斷 ET0=1。 } void init_interrupt() //中斷初始化 { TMOD|=0x01。039。amp。039。amp。039。amp。039。nz[9]==time2[9]) flag6=1。nz[8]==time2[8]amp。nz[5]==time2[5]amp。nz[4]==time2[4]amp。nz[1]==time2[1]amp。 if(nz[0]==time2[0]amp。 nz[9]=nz_second%10+39。 nz[8]=nz_second/10+39。 17 nz[5]=nz_minute%10+39。 nz[4]=nz_minute/10+39。 nz[1]=nz_hour%10+39。 nz[0]=nz_hour/10+39。 // week[5]=39。 // week[4]=day%10+39。 time2[9]=second%10+39。 time2[8]=second/10+39。 time2[5]=minute%10+39。 time2[4]=minute/10+39。 time2[1]=hour%10+39。 time2[0]=hour/10+39。 time1[11]=date%10+39。 time1[10]=date/10+39。 time1[7]=month%10+39。 time1[6]=month/10+39。 time1[3]=year%10+39。 time1[2]=year/10+39。 //溫度小數(shù)點(diǎn)后第一位 DelayMs(100)。 //小數(shù)點(diǎn) wendu[11]=temp2%10+39。039。039。 39。039。 temp3=temp2/10。 總之,在以后的學(xué)習(xí)生活中我們將以加倍的努力,給幫助過(guò)我們的學(xué)校、老師及同學(xué)們以回報(bào)。 感謝多年來(lái)傳授我們知識(shí)的老師們,更要感謝那些對(duì)我們學(xué)習(xí)上支持和鼓勵(lì)的人。 非常感謝大家在我們的課程設(shè)計(jì)中,給予我們極大的幫助,使我們對(duì)整個(gè)課程設(shè)計(jì)的思路有了總體的把握,并耐心的幫我們解決了許多實(shí)際問(wèn)題,使我們有了很大的收獲。在這段時(shí)間里,我們從他們身上不僅學(xué)到了許多的專業(yè)知識(shí),更感受到他們工作中的兢兢業(yè)業(yè),生活中的平易近人。本次課程設(shè)計(jì)是在老師的指導(dǎo)和同學(xué)們的幫助下修改完成的。通過(guò)本 次實(shí)習(xí),我 們深刻地認(rèn)識(shí)到自學(xué)的重要性, 我 們要以一種良好的態(tài)度去迎接每一次 挫折和挑戰(zhàn)。 在以 后的學(xué)習(xí)實(shí)踐和工作中,更要學(xué)會(huì)自學(xué),要有耐心和毅力,知識(shí)更新一日千里,要活到老、學(xué)到老,在大學(xué)課堂上 學(xué)的只是方法,至于其中 深層次 的內(nèi)容,還要靠自己去挖掘,所謂 “師傅領(lǐng)進(jìn)門,修行在個(gè)人”就是這個(gè)道理,這才是成年人的學(xué)習(xí)生活。 實(shí) 習(xí)兩周很快就過(guò)去了,學(xué)到了很多,很充實(shí), 也 很有成就感。 實(shí)習(xí)過(guò)程中一直在 網(wǎng)上及書上尋找著對(duì)自己有價(jià)值的東西,我們的收獲很多,學(xué)到的東西也很多,同時(shí)明白了一個(gè)道理:學(xué)習(xí)能力 不是指自己學(xué)習(xí)書本知識(shí)并會(huì)做各種難題的能力,而是發(fā)現(xiàn)問(wèn)題 并能獨(dú)立解決問(wèn)題的能力 。 找出錯(cuò) 原因 時(shí) 就要從主程序開始分析,調(diào)用子程序時(shí)再 轉(zhuǎn)到 子程序 里查看,還要特別 注意 循環(huán)。通過(guò)此問(wèn)題,我們發(fā)現(xiàn)做項(xiàng)目的時(shí)候必須對(duì)所用的元器件的原理非常的清楚,不然編程時(shí)就會(huì)出現(xiàn)各種小問(wèn)題,而導(dǎo)致修改時(shí)都無(wú)從下手。雖然遇到很多困難, 但是 修改之后都能得到預(yù)期的結(jié)果,還是有點(diǎn)成就感的。通過(guò)這次單片機(jī)實(shí)習(xí), 我們 15 能夠?qū)⑺鶎W(xué)的知識(shí)運(yùn)用到實(shí)踐中。 圖一:開機(jī)初始化顯示 圖二:當(dāng)前溫度時(shí)間日期顯示 12 圖三:整點(diǎn)報(bào)時(shí)時(shí)間到 圖四:鬧鐘時(shí)間到 13 圖五:秒 表功能 圖六:秒表清零 14 圖七:鬧鐘設(shè)置 圖八:時(shí)間調(diào)整 心得體會(huì) 這次實(shí)習(xí)對(duì)我們來(lái)說(shuō)是一次很好的鍛煉, 尤其對(duì)于我們自動(dòng)化專業(yè)。 整點(diǎn)時(shí), 蜂鳴器響,并且會(huì)根據(jù)整點(diǎn)時(shí)間響相應(yīng)次數(shù)。無(wú)源蜂鳴器接直流電是不會(huì)工作的。有源蜂鳴器內(nèi)部帶振蕩源,無(wú)源蜂鳴器內(nèi)部不帶振蕩源。本系統(tǒng)使用的是電磁式蜂鳴器。 蜂鳴器模塊 圖 八 聲音輸出模塊 10 蜂鳴器是一種一體化結(jié)構(gòu)的電子訊響器,廣泛用于電子產(chǎn)品中作發(fā)聲報(bào)警。通過(guò)對(duì)標(biāo)志位數(shù)值的判斷來(lái)完成對(duì)秒表的控制。 圖 七 獨(dú)立 鍵盤模塊 這里的獨(dú)立按鍵,我們只用到了 K1,主要用于實(shí)現(xiàn)秒表功能 ,采用定時(shí)器 1 來(lái)對(duì)秒表進(jìn)行精確的定時(shí),我們的秒表可以精確到 秒。按下 S8 鍵可以啟動(dòng)鬧鐘設(shè)置 功能,這時(shí)的 S S S10 以及 S S7 可以復(fù)用,實(shí)現(xiàn)對(duì)鬧鐘的調(diào)節(jié),按下 S12 鍵后,系統(tǒng)退出對(duì)時(shí)間和鬧鐘的調(diào)整,進(jìn)入日期、時(shí)間、星期以及溫度顯示界面。它能直接讀出被測(cè)溫度,因此可以通過(guò)簡(jiǎn)單的編程實(shí)現(xiàn)溫度顯示與溫度控制。 8 *注釋 3:如背光和模塊共用一個(gè)電源,可以將模塊上的 JA、 JK用焊錫短接。 7 表 一 LCD12864 各引腳接口說(shuō)明 管腳號(hào) 管腳名稱 電平 管腳功能描述 1 VSS 0V 電源地 2 VCC +5V 電源正 3 V0 對(duì)比度(亮度)調(diào)整 4 RS(CS) H/L RS=“H”, 表示 DB7—— DB0 為顯示數(shù)據(jù) RS=“L”, 表示 DB7—— DB0 為顯示指令數(shù)據(jù) 5 R/W(SID) H/L R/W=“H”,E=“H”, 數(shù)據(jù)被讀到 DB7—— DB0 R/W=“L”,E=“H→L”, DB7 —— DB0 的數(shù)據(jù)被寫到 IR或 DR 6 E(SCLK) H/L 使能信號(hào) 7 DB0 H/L 三態(tài)數(shù)據(jù)線 8 DB1 H/L 三態(tài)數(shù)據(jù)線 9 DB2 H/L 三態(tài)數(shù)據(jù)線 10 DB3 H/L 三態(tài)數(shù)據(jù)線 11 DB4 H/L 三態(tài)數(shù)據(jù)線 12 DB5 H/L 三態(tài)數(shù)據(jù)線 13 DB6 H/L 三態(tài)數(shù)據(jù)線 14 DB7 H/L 三態(tài)數(shù)據(jù)線 15 PSB H/L H: 8位或 4 位并口方式, L:串口方式(見注釋 1) 16 NC 空腳 17 /RESET H/L 復(fù)位端,低電平有效(見注釋 2) 18 VOUT LCD 驅(qū)動(dòng)電壓輸出端 19 A VDD 背光源正端( +5V)(見注釋 3) 20 K VSS 背光源負(fù)端(見注釋 3) *注釋 1:如在實(shí)際應(yīng)用中僅使用并口通訊模式,可將 PSB 接固定高電平,也可以將模塊上的 J8 和 “VCC” 用焊錫短接。 在導(dǎo)入程序后液晶顯示屏上顯示制作人姓名、學(xué)號(hào)和 問(wèn)候語(yǔ) ,而后跳到當(dāng)前日期和時(shí)間,并顯示當(dāng)前溫度,通過(guò)按鍵控制進(jìn)入秒表、鬧鐘 等 功能的顯 示??梢燥@示 84行 1616 點(diǎn)陣的漢字 . 也可完成圖形顯示 .低電壓低功耗是其又一顯著特點(diǎn)。 ( 4) 功耗低 : 相對(duì)而言,液晶顯示器的功耗主要消耗在其內(nèi)部的電極和驅(qū)動(dòng) IC 上,因而耗電量比其它顯示器要少得多。 ( 2) 數(shù)字式接口 : 液晶顯示器都是數(shù)字式的,和單 片機(jī)系統(tǒng)的接口更加簡(jiǎn)單可靠,操作更加方便。 本次實(shí)習(xí)主要用 LCD 液晶顯示器, 在單片機(jī)系統(tǒng)中應(yīng)用液晶顯示器作為輸出器件有以下幾個(gè)優(yōu)點(diǎn) : ( 1) 顯示質(zhì)量高 : 由于液晶顯示器每一個(gè)點(diǎn)在收到信號(hào)后就一直保持那種色彩和亮度,恒定發(fā)光,而不像陰極射線管顯示器( CRT)那樣需要不斷刷新亮點(diǎn)。 在 SCLK 為低電平時(shí),才能將 RST 置為高電平, I/O 為串行數(shù)據(jù)輸入端(雙向) ,SCLK 始終是輸入端。如果在傳送過(guò)程中 RST 置為低電平,則會(huì)終止此次數(shù)據(jù)傳送, I/O 引腳變?yōu)楦咦钁B(tài)。 RST 輸入有兩種功能:首先, RST接通控制邏輯,允許地址 /命令序列送入移位寄存器;其次, RST 提供終止單字節(jié)或多字節(jié)數(shù)據(jù)的傳送手段。 X1 和 X2 是振蕩源,外接 晶振。當(dāng) Vcc2 大于 Vcc1+ 時(shí), Vcc2 給 DS1302 供電。在主電源關(guān)閉的情況下,也能保持時(shí)鐘的連續(xù)運(yùn)行。 XTAL2:來(lái)自反向振蕩器的輸出。在 FLASH 編程期間,此引腳也用于施加 12V編程電源( VPP)。 EA/VPP:當(dāng) EA 保持低電平時(shí),則在此期間外部程序存儲(chǔ)器( 0000HFFFFH), 不管是否有內(nèi)部程序存儲(chǔ)器。在由外部程序存儲(chǔ)器取指期間,每個(gè)機(jī)器周期兩次 PSEN 低電平 有效。如果微處理器在外部執(zhí)行狀態(tài) ALE 禁止,置位無(wú)效。此時(shí), ALE 只有在執(zhí)行 MOVX、MOVC 指令 時(shí), ALE 才起作用。然而要注意的是:每當(dāng)用作外部數(shù)據(jù)存儲(chǔ)器時(shí),將跳過(guò)一個(gè) ALE脈沖。在 低電平 時(shí), ALE 端以不變的頻率周期輸出正脈沖信號(hào),此頻率為振蕩器頻率的 1/6。 ALE/PROG:當(dāng)訪問(wèn)外部存儲(chǔ)器時(shí),地址鎖存允許的輸出電平用于鎖存地 址的低 位字節(jié)。 RST:復(fù)位輸入。當(dāng) P3 口寫入 1 后,它們被內(nèi)部上拉為高電平,并用作輸入。 P2 口在 FLASH 編程和校驗(yàn)時(shí)接收高八位地址信號(hào)和控制信號(hào)。 當(dāng) P2 口用于外部程序存儲(chǔ)器或 16 位地址外部數(shù)據(jù)存儲(chǔ)器進(jìn)行存取時(shí), P2 口輸出地址的高八位。 P2 口: P2 口為一個(gè)內(nèi)部上拉電阻的 8 位雙向 I/O 口, P2 口緩沖器可接收,輸出 4 個(gè)TTL 門電流,當(dāng) P2 口被寫 1 時(shí),其管腳被內(nèi)部上拉電阻拉高,可作為輸入。 P1 口管腳寫入 1 后,被內(nèi)部上拉為高,可用作輸入, P1 口被外部下拉為低電平時(shí),將輸出電流,這是由于內(nèi)部上拉的緣故。在 FIASH 編程時(shí), P0 口作為原碼輸入 口,當(dāng) FIASH 進(jìn)行校驗(yàn)時(shí), P0 口 輸出原碼,此時(shí) P0 口 外部必須被拉高。當(dāng) P1 口的管腳第一次寫 1 時(shí),被定義為高阻輸入。 GND:接地。 如下圖所示。 主要單元電路 AT89S52 單片機(jī)主控制模塊 AT89S52 是美國(guó) ATMEL 公司生產(chǎn)的低功耗、高性能 CMOS 8 位單片機(jī),片內(nèi)含 8K bytes 的可系統(tǒng)編程的 Flash 只讀程序存儲(chǔ)器,器件采用 ATMEL 公司的高密度、非易失性 存儲(chǔ)技術(shù)生產(chǎn),兼容標(biāo)準(zhǔn) 8051 指令系統(tǒng)及引腳。 設(shè)計(jì)與實(shí)現(xiàn) 電路設(shè)計(jì)框圖 系統(tǒng) 概述 本系統(tǒng)是以
點(diǎn)擊復(fù)制文檔內(nèi)容
法律信息相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1